F1: Andretti Pushes Ahead with 2025 Debut Plans Amidst Uncertainty, Reveals Wind Tunnel Model

Andretti is now working with General Motors on a model Formula 1 car, which has parts in production and is in the wind tunnel. It's drawing top players from the most prestigious clubs in the sport.

The Andretti Cadillac Formula 1 team is diligently working towards making its debut in 2025, with the unveiling of its initial wind tunnel model marking a significant milestone. Even though the FIA approved Andretti's bid on October 2, the team is still waiting for the F1 organisation and CEO Stefano Domenicali to approve it in the second stage. This group has been hard at work in the wind tunnel at Toyota's Cologne facility since the month of October. Based on an early confirmation of their arrival, the recently revealed image depicts the 2024-spec model, which is expected to provide the framework for the comprehensive 2025 test programme. Even though the official permit is still pending, the team has been busy hiring more people at their design headquarters in Silverstone and is planning to move to a bigger site nearby. In the case that the team decides to postpone its debut until 2026, it will be necessary for them to relocate their attention to the newly implemented rules. Andretti, like other teams, will be unable to perform aerodynamic modifications until January 1, 2025.

F1: Andretti and Formula 1

Andretti is currently waiting for a decision from Formula One Management (FOM), but the current ten teams are strongly opposed because they are worried about commercial revenue loss and the disruptive impact of a new team. The strategic restructuring of Andretti puts it in a good position to deal with the ever-changing Formula 1 landscape, notwithstanding this opposition.

Current Formula One teams are very opposed to Andretti's admission because they are worried about the financial ramifications and the disruptive effects of further competition, even if the FIA has approved his entry. The final decision will be made by FOM.

Even though it won't be competing in 2024, Andretti is developing a model for that year anyhow in an effort to improve its operational procedures. A diverse collection of individuals, drawn from different teams and, in some cases, straight out of university, work together during this phase.

Another interesting aspect of it is the developing drama around the decision of Formula One teams regarding the American team's entry. This decision will be made during the following two years, before the new Concorde Agreement is put into effect.
